The lynx is a medium-sized wild cat found across the northern forests of North America, Europe, and Asia. This solitary hunter is known for its stealth and athletic prowess, thriving in rugged, often snow-covered habitats. The physical capabilities of the lynx, particularly its use of explosive power, often spark curiosity regarding the limits of its vertical movement. Its leaping ability is an adaptation for survival where speed and precision are paramount for securing a meal.
Maximum Vertical Leap
The maximum vertical jump of a lynx is often estimated to reach up to 10 feet (3 meters) from a running or bounding start. This height is significant, considering the average shoulder height of a large species like the Eurasian lynx is only around 2.5 feet. Researchers have observed a lynx springing straight up from a standing start, reaching heights of over 6.5 feet (2 meters) in controlled settings. The precise measurement varies depending on the species and context, such as a standing jump versus a full-power leap used in hunting. The Eurasian lynx, the largest of the four species, sometimes demonstrates a jumping capacity four times its own body height.
Physical Adaptations for Jumping
The lynx’s body structure facilitates this explosive vertical movement. Its hind legs are disproportionately long and muscular compared to its front legs, functioning like powerful springs. This anatomical arrangement allows for a deep crouch and rapid extension, translating stored elastic energy into the upward thrust needed for a high leap. The skeletal and muscular systems work together to deliver this power over a short distance, a requirement for pouncing.
The lynx possesses specialized paws that play a role in the launch, particularly on uneven or snowy ground. These large, heavily padded paws act like natural snowshoes, distributing the animal’s weight to prevent sinking into deep snow. The wide paw surface provides a stable base for takeoff, ensuring maximum traction. Fur covering the underside of the paws also enhances grip on slick surfaces, giving the animal a firm platform for its powerful jump. This combination of muscular hindquarters and traction-optimized feet aids vertical agility in its northern home.
Functional Role of Jumping in the Wild
The lynx utilizes its jumping ability as a core component of its hunting strategy. This skill is deployed in the final stage of an attack, where the cat pounces with precision on its prey. The rapid, high leap ensures the distance is covered quickly and delivers enough force to incapacitate a target, a tactic effective against its favored meal, the snowshoe hare.
The powerful vertical jump also serves a functional role in traversing its snowy habitat. The ability to leap high allows the lynx to clear dense undergrowth, fallen logs, or deep drifts of snow that might impede a less agile predator. This bounding movement conserves energy and allows the cat to maintain speed and stealth across challenging winter landscapes. The capacity for a sudden, straight-up jump may also occasionally be used to catch birds in flight or to reach prey positioned on an elevated surface.
